Meet Our Practitioners

Our team includes in-training, qualified, and licensed mental health professionals with different areas of training, where you can receive care that fits your needs. All MINDAKAMI’s practitioners hold at least a Master’s degree.

Registered Counsellor

Licensed by the Lembaga Kaunselor Malaysia. Qualified to provide therapy and guidance in areas such as mental health, career, family, relationship, personal development, and stress management.

Registered Clinical Psychologist

Licensed under the Allied Health Professions Act (Malaysia). Qualified to conduct comprehensive psychological assessments and diagnoses, and provide therapy for psychological issues.

Trainee Counsellor / Clinical Psychologist

Currently pursuing a Master’s degree. Under supervision to become a registered mental health practitioner.
